| convertible |
| 1. adj. Able to be converted, particularly: |
| 2. adj. Able to be exchanged, one for the other, especially |
| 3. adj. # (historical currency) Able to be exchanged for specie. |
| 4. adj. # (currency) Able to be exchanged for foreign currency. |
| 5. adj. # (finance) Able to be exchanged for a different class of security (usually common stock) under certain set terms. |
| 6. adj. (logic) Able to undergo conversion (i.e., inversion) without falsehood. |
| 7. adj. Able to be turned, especially |
| 8. adj. # (obsolete) Able to be turned in a different direction. |
| 9. adj. # Able to be turned to a different purpose. |
| 10. adj. # Able to be turned to a different religion or belief. |
| 11. adj. Able to be turned into a different thing, especially |
| 12. adj. # (vehicles) Able to change from a closed to an open frame and back again. |
| 13. adj. # (obsolete) Able to be easily digested. |
| 14. n. (dated, in plural) Interchangeable things or terms. |
| 15. n. (vehicles) A convertible car: a car with a removable or foldable roof able to convert from a closed to open vehicle and back again. |
| 16. n. (finance) A convertible security: a stock, bond, etc. that can be turned into another (usually common stock) under certain set terms. |
| 17. n. (computing) A computer able to convert from laptop to tablet and back again. |
